About 300 National Guard soldiers arrived in Los Angeles early on Sunday based on orders from US President Donald Trump, as he set out outside a federal complex that remained largely calm and without great protests two days after clashes with immigration authorities.
The publication was the first time in six decades, the National Guard of the state was activated without the request of its ruler, according to the Brennan Center for Justice.
On Sunday morning, some forces were stationed outside the detention center in the center of Los Angeles, wearing tactical equipment and long rifles in front of armored vehicles.
A small number of demonstrators gathered at the scene, along with California MP Maxine Water, a democratic, demanded to enter the facility.
The arrival of the National Guard followed two days of protests that started on Friday in the center of Los Angeles before spreading on Saturday to Paramount, a severe Latin city south of the city, and the neighboring compound.
Since federal agents set up a launching zone on Saturday near the home warehouse in Paramount, the demonstrators sought to prevent American border patrol cars, with some rocks and cement cuts. In response, the factors in riot equipment fired tear gas, flash explosives and pepper balls.
Tensions were high after a series of surveying by immigration authorities the day before, as the outcome of the week -long migrant arrests increased to 100.
